GEORGE III SILVER FOOTED SALVER,probably Thomas Hannam and John Carter, London, 1766. On three claw and ball feet, stepped wave-form border with beaded rim, centered with chased armorial crest - 40 oz.; 14 1/4 in. diam. Estimate $700-900
PROVENANCE: Estate of Benjamin Franklin Kahn, Chevy Chase, MD
Marks crisp, light surface scratches, armorial partially rubbed, underside with areas of shallow abrasions. In overall very good condition.
